Huang Shijie 0730016465 mtd: de-select the chip when it is not used
When we scan several nand chips with nand_scan(), such as
     .......................
      nand_scan(*, 2);
     .......................

In nand_scan_ident(), the maxchips will become 2, so the current code
will select chip 1 to read the device ID. But the chip 0 is still
selected in this case.

To make the logic clear, we'd better de-select the chip when it is not used.

This patch de-select the nand chip if it is not used any more.
